In line with the SPRUCE initiative, concerned as it is with Statistics in Public Resources, Utilities and Care of the Environment, the recent conference brought together leading workers from a widely multidisciplinary background. The SPRUCE IV programme was divided into five thematic sections:
- Small Area Studies and Disease Mapping
- Atmospheric Pollution Studies
- Disease Risks and Social Effects
- Effects of Radiation
- Agriculture and the Food Chain
